Transaction 035af69706eec350764639987da99f3bea3cc2d256f169c25ae01e5eedc56356
1 Input
1 Output
-
035af69706eec350764639987da99f3bea3cc2d256f169c25ae01e5eedc56356:0
- value
- 1458355
- script pubkey
- OP_0 OP_PUSHBYTES_20 e381fc95eea6bd2e542790522555dfe2c8a06070
- address
- bc1quwqle90w567ju4p8jpfz24wluty2qcrsy5mphd